This analyzes your Yuque documents to extract writing style patterns across seven dimensions: structure, tone, vocabulary, length, formatting, references, and expression. Point it at a doc (or several) and you get a structured breakdown with concrete examples, like "uses H2/H3 headings only, mixes English technical terms with Chinese explanations, inserts tables every 2-3 paragraphs." The output is designed to be actionable, so you could hand it to someone and they'd know how to mimic that style. Useful if you're trying to keep a consistent voice across documentation or want to learn from well-written pieces. Works with personal repos only, requires yuque-mcp server connected to your account.
